Output 985bb14c16d711d75bbab36e031d365f78de8868cdf61d568a270844c6a08b30:14

value
2859286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cc1247e012b92c647a16695f3d7d996bb481f8a OP_EQUAL
address
3Bc4H3KtuzFc9BzjYbnyaj6AiXoJbsXQTB
transaction
985bb14c16d711d75bbab36e031d365f78de8868cdf61d568a270844c6a08b30
spent
true